Julie Edge conscience clear after resignation
An Onchan MHK says her conscience is clear after she severed ties with the LibVan Party – little over 14 months after being elected.
Julie Edge claimed she’d been restricted from fulfilling her role properly and stopped from asking oral questions about health issues by party leader, Health Minister Kate Beecroft.
Her former LibVan colleague, Ramsey MHK Lawrie Hooper, subsequently accused Ms Edge of lying.
Ms Edge says she has no regrets about resigning.
